Kit di valutazione e kit di avvio, kit di sviluppo completi e progetti di riferimento specifici dell'applicazione.
IDE, compilatori e catene di strumenti di TI e dei membri della rete di progettazione TI.
Supporto dei sistemi operativi da TI e dalla rete di progettazione TI. Software specifico delle periferiche e specifico delle applicazioni, framework e codici software
C2000 offre diverse piattaforme hardware per accelerare lo sviluppo mediante i microcontroller C2000. Dai controlSTICK con fattore di forma USB a basso costo alle piattaforme di sviluppo delle applicazioni con funzionalità complete per applicazioni solari, di controllo motori, illuminazione ed alimentazione digitale, il microcontroller C2000 offre un'ampia scelta di strumenti di sviluppo hardware progettati per facilitare lo sviluppo e consentire ai clienti di commercializzare i prodotti più velocemente.
I controlSTICK sono strumenti stile unità USB autonomi e dal costo ridotto che consentono la valutazione immediata. Con un emulatore integrato, pin di accesso e progetti di esempio, un nuovo utente è in grado di attivare i dispositivi C2000 in pochi minuti e senza problemi causati dall'hardware.
Con le controlCARD per C2000, il microcontroller e tutti i dispositivi di supporto necessari sono inseriti in una scheda figlia socket DIM standard compatibile con pin. Con un'interfaccia compatibile con plug-in comune, le controlCARD consentono agli utenti di sperimentare velocemente con i diversi MCU C2000 nei kit di sviluppo applicazione semplicemente inserendo una nuova controlCARD. Le controlCARD sono utilizzate in tutti i kit di sviluppo TMS320C2000 oltre la piattaforma controlSTICK.
I kit introduttivi per C2000 includono una docking station compatibile con controlCARD che fornisce accesso alla maggior parte dei pin della controlCARD, offrendo al contempo una piattaforma di prototipazione per i microcontroller C2000.
I kit introduttivi alle periferiche consentono agli utenti di C2000 e agli studenti universitari di imparare facilmente come utilizzare tutte le periferiche avanzate su un microcontroller C2000. Questi kit, compatibili con controlCARD, includono progetti di esempio di hardware e software integrati specifici per la sperimentazione con le periferiche sugli MCU C2000.
Kit | Codice articolo | Descrizione | Prezzo | Ordina subito |
---|---|---|---|---|
LAUNCHXL-F28027 Piccolo LaunchPad | LAUNCHXL-F28027 | La LaunchPad si basa su Piccolo TMS320F28027 con funzioni univoche come il 64 KB della flash integrata, 8 canali PWM, eCAP, ADC a 12 bit, I2C, SPI, UART e molto altro. | 17 USD | Ordina subito |
BoosterPack LED BOOSTXL-C2KLED | BOOSTXL-C2KLED | Il BoosterPack LED C2000 dimostra il controllo di 3 convertitori di avvio per attivare tre stringhe LED (rossa, verde e blu). Sono fornite svariate opzioni di interfaccia utente incluse nel controllo touch capacitivo utilizzando un MSP430 e il boosterpack touch capacitivo MSP430 (430BOOST-SENSE1) nonché l'applicazione GUI del PC. | 30 USD | Ordina subito |
Fornisce piattaforme di riferimento e apprendimento complete per gli spazi applicazione chiave, compresi controllo motori, alimentazione digitale, solare e illuminazione LED. Progettato per i tecnici con una conoscenza pratica dell'applicazione che desiderano imparare come un microcontroller C2000 è in grado di migliorare l'applicazione target. I kit includono guide rapide con un'interfaccia grafica utente che in genere fornisce una rapida introduzione al kit e alle relative funzionalità. Per lo sviluppo più avanzato, altri progetti di esempio e guide per l'utente assistono l'utente nella comprensione dello sviluppo e del funzionamento del kit.
Kit di applicazione per controllo e comando motori
Kit di applicazione solare
Kit di applicazione per alimentazione digitale
Kit di applicazione per illuminazione
Kit di applicazione per comunicazioni
La maggior parte dei C2000 è spedita con un emulatore JTAG USB XDS100 integrato, tuttavia molte terze parti offrono svariati emulatori JTAG, comprese le opzioni economiche. Per i target che controllano le apparecchiature a tensione o corrente elevata, si consiglia di utilizzare un emulatore isolato galvanicamente per evitare danni all'apparecchiatura a causa della terra.
Con il connettore contolCARD DIM100, la progettazione della controlCARD risulta facile su qualsiasi prototipo
Kit | Codice articolo | Descrizione | Prezzo | Ordina subito |
---|---|---|---|---|
Connettore controlCARD DIM100 | TMDSDIM100CON5PK | Pacchetto di 5 connettori DIM100 (denominati DIMM 100 da DigiKey e Mouser) per l'uso con qualsiasi strumento controlCARD. Cinque connettori sono il codice articolo Molex 87630-1001 o equivalente. | 8,00 USD |
Compatibili con kit per sviluppatori PFC e controllo motori ad alta tensione
Kit | Codice articolo | Descrizione | Prezzo | Ordina subito |
---|---|---|---|---|
Motore a induzione AC per TMDSHVMTRPFCKIT | HVACIMTR | Il kit motore ACI è progettato per i clienti che desiderano utilizzare il kit per sviluppatori PFC e il controllo motori ad alta tensione con un motore a induzione AC. | 299,00 USD | Ordina subito |
Motore sincrono con magnete permanente per TMDSHVMTRPFCKIT | HVPMSMMTR | Il kit include un motore PMSM con encoder integrato, pronto all'uso con il software kit controllo motori. | 299,00 USD | Ordina subito |
Motore DC brushless per TMDSHVMTRPFCKIT | HVBLDCMTR | Il kit motore BLDC è progettato per i clienti che desiderano utilizzare il kit per sviluppatori PFC e il controllo motori ad alta tensione con un motore DC brushless. | 199,00 USD | Ordina subito |
IDE, compilatori e catene di strumenti di TI e dei membri della rete di progettazione TI.
Code Composer Studio™ (CCStudio) è un ambiente di sviluppo integrato basato su Eclipse per DSP TI, microcontroller e processori di applicazione. CCStudio include una suite di strumenti utilizzati per sviluppare ed eseguire il debug delle applicazioni embedded. Include compilatori per ognuna delle famiglie di dispositivi di TI, editor del codice sorgente, ambiente di creazione progetto, debugger, profiler, simulatori e molte altre funzionalità. CCStudio offre una singola interfaccia utente che fornisce assistenza in ogni passo del flusso di sviluppo dell'applicazione. Strumenti e interfacce familiari consentono agli utenti di iniziare più velocemente che mai e aggiungere funzionalità alla propria applicazione grazie ai sofisticati strumenti di produttività.
Scarica Code Composer Studio v5
Per le versioni gratuite di CCSv4, scaricare l'edizione XDS100 (TMDSCCS-HWN01A) per l'uso gratuito con gli emulatori XDS100, o l'edizione MCU (TMDFCCS-MCULTD) per l'uso limitato da codice con tutti gli MCU TI.
IDE | Codice articolo | Descrizione | Supporto emulatore XDS100 | Versione di prova | Versione completa |
---|---|---|---|---|---|
Code Composer Studio v4 | CCS-FREE | IDE basata su Eclipse compatibile con tutti gli MCU e i DSP TI | XDS100 V1 XDS100 V2 |
Illimitato con l'emulatore XDS100 (limite di 32 KB senza XDS100) | 445 USD |
** Non compatibile con il software controlSUITE™.
Gli approcci al debugging tradizionali (modalità di arresto) richiedono che i programmatori arrestino completamente il sistema per interrompere tutti i passi ed evitare di gestire le interruzioni, rendendo il debugging estremamente difficile se il sistema/l'applicazione presenta vincoli in tempo reale. Il supporto del debug in tempo reale offre uno strumento migliore per il comportamento del sistema nel mondo reale consentendo ai programmatori di arrestare ed esaminare l'applicazione, pur gestendo le interruzioni con stato di urgenza specifiche dell'utente.
Controlli VISSIM / embedded Developer ™ consente di creare facilmente diagrammi a blocchi grafici che simulerà e generare efficiente punto di codice C fisso e variabile per TI C2000 obiettivi. VISSIM ha il supporto profondo per periferiche on-chip come ADC, PWM, e comparatori. Con la configurazione automatica dei principali compito guidato timer, include un completo RTOS con un numero illimitato di attività di pre-emptible, la creazione semplice gestore di interrupt, built-in di interrupt sulla seriale di I / O in coda per la SPI, UART e I2C e una interfaccia esterna a portata di mano dati codificati e funzioni. Sovrapposto di Code Composer, VISSIM fornisce un ambiente di debug completo di variazione del guadagno interattivo e oscilloscopi digitali per osservare il comportamento bersaglio.
Vedi maggiori informazioni su VISSIM / ECDSupporto dei sistemi operativi da TI e dalla rete di progettazione TI. Software specifico delle periferiche e specifico delle applicazioni, framework e codici software
Un'unica soluzione per tutte le esigenze relative a software e hardware per gli MCU C2000. controlSUITE è un archivio di progettazione per software, documentazione e hardware per i microcontroller C2000. Utilizza la pratica interfaccia grafica utente per individuare rapidamente il supporto necessario, sia che si tratti di codice di esempio o perfino di schemi hardware. Non è necessario effettuare ricerche infinite di tabelle o prodotti software oppure spostarsi all'interno di complesse directory sul computer. controlSUITE consente di trovare facilmente il software necessario sia che si tratti di librerie runtime, librerie di applicazioni, esempi di supporto EVM, schemi hardware, documentazione e molto altro.
Il kernel DSP/BIOS(TM) di TI è un kernel multi-tasking in real-time scalabile. Insieme alle reti, le comunicazioni DSP del microprocessore e i moduli driver associati, DSP/BIOS offre una base solida perfino per le applicazioni DSP più sofisticate. DSP/BIOS è stato collaudato in centinaia di progetti dei clienti ed è uno dei sistemi operativi in real-time più ampiamente utilizzato in tutto il mondo. DSP/BIOS non richiede licenze di runtime ed è supportato dalle organizzazioni di formazione e supporto mondiali di Texas Instruments.
SYS/BIOS™ 6.x è un kernel in real-time avanzato per l'impiego in una vasta gamma di DSP, ARM e microcontroller. È progettato per l'uso in applicazioni embedded che necessitano di pianificazione, sincronizzazione e strumentazione in real-time. Fornisce multitasking di tipo preemptive, astrazione hardware e gestione della memoria. Rispetto ai predecessori, DSP/BIOS™ 5.x presenta molti miglioramenti dal punto di vista di funzionalità e prestazioni. I clienti che richiedono un sistema operativo in real-time più completo, stack USB e di rete, potrebbero prendere in considerazione TI-RTOS, disponibile per dispositivi TI selezionati. TI-RTOS si basa su SYS/BIOS per consentire agli sviluppatori una facile transizione a una soluzione RTOS completa.
TI-RTOS è un sistema operativo in real-time (RTOS) per i microcontroller C2000™ dual-core C28x + ARM Cortex-M3 ARM® Cortex-M3 + C28x. Unisce un kernel multitasking in real-time a componenti aggiuntivi middleware, inclusi stack USB e TCP/IP, un sistema di file FAT e driver per dispositivi, consentendo agli sviluppatori di concentrarsi sulla differenziazione della propria applicazione. TI-RTOS si basa su componenti software esistenti collaudati, come SYSBIOS e controlSUITE e include il codice sorgente completo. Il sistema operativo in real-time completamente collaudato non richiede costi iniziali o licenze di runtime.
Il metodo di distribuzione del software Piccolo InstaSPIN-FOC e InstaSPIN-MOTION offre le ultime novità in fatto di tecniche orientate all'oggetto C e codifica basata su API.
Sito Web InstaSPIN-FOCI pacchetti di progettazione SafeTI-60730 per la sicurezza funzionale includono librerie software conformi a IEC 60730:2010, che supportano anche gli standard di sicurezza funzionale UL 1998:2008 e IEC 60335-1:2010. Le librerie conformi consentono ai produttori di sistemi per applicazioni consumer di ottenere la certificazione del sistema in modo più facile e veloce.
Sito Web SafeTILa piattaforma C2000 offre un'ampia gamma di dispositivi flash su chip. Sono disponibili diverse opzioni per caricare la memoria flash con l'IP software. Di seguito è riportato un elenco degli strumenti di programmazione flash.
Nome | Descrizione | Fornitore |
---|---|---|
UniFlash | Uniflash CCS è uno strumento standalone utilizzato per programmare la memoria flash negli MCU di TI. Unflash include interfaccia grafica utente, riga di comando e interfaccia di script. Uniflash CCS è disponibile gratuitamente. | Texas Instruments |
C2Prog | C2Prog è uno strumento di programmazione di tipo industriale flash per gli MCU C2000™ e MSP430™ di TI. Oltre che far affidamento esclusivamente sulle JTAG come interfaccia di comunicazione tra lo strumento di programmazione e l'MCU, C2Prog supporta anche RS-232, RS-485, TCP/IP, USB e CAN (Controller Area Network). Il programmatore è pertanto adatto per lo sviluppo sul campo dove la porta JTAG è generalmente non accessibile o non pratica. | codeskin
|
FlashPro 2000 | FlashPro2000 è un programmatore flash USB per gli MCU serie C2000 di Texas Instruments (TMS320F28x) | Elptronic
|
Fornitore | Descrizione |
---|---|
BP Microsystems | BP Microsystems fornisce soluzioni di programmazione complete a clienti in tutto il mondo. La società offre una linea completa di programmatori universali e di dispositivi su sito singolo e di sistemi di programmazione concorrenti multi-sito. |
Data I/O | Data I/O fornisce soluzioni di programmazione complete a clienti in tutto il mondo. La società offre una linea completa di programmatori universali e di dispositivi su sito singolo e di sistemi di programmazione concorrenti multi-sito. |
Per il software e informazioni sulla tecnologia PLC (Power Line Communications) basata su C2000, visitare la nostra pagina PLC:
Comunicazioni power-linePacchetto software | Descrizione | Standard supportati |
---|---|---|
CAN | ssCAN è un dispositivo CAN in real-time dalle elevate prestazioni con latenza di interruzione minima ottimizzato per la famiglia C2000. Supporta canali CAN singoli e multipli nell'intera gamma di dispositivi C2000. | ISO 11898-1 ISO 11898-2 ISO 11898-3 ISO 11898-5 |
CANopen | ssCANopen è uno stack di protocollo CANopen in real-time dalle elevate prestazioni che supporta un flusso di dati di 15 Mbps. Il prodotto è ottimizzato specificatamente per C2000. | CiA 301 CiA 302 CiA 303 CiA 401 …. CiA 455 |
SAE J1939 | ssJ1939 è uno stack di protocollo SAE J1939 dalle elevate prestazioni che supporta un flusso di dati di 20 Mbps. Il prodotto è ottimizzato specificatamente per C2000. | SAE J1939-11 SAE J1939-15 SAE J1939-21 SAE J1939-71 SAE J1939-73 SAE J1939-81 |
ISO 15765 | ssI15765 è uno stack di protocollo ISO 15765 dalle elevate prestazioni che supporta un flusso di dati di 20 Mbps. Il prodotto è ottimizzato specificatamente per C2000. | ISO 15765-2 ISO 15765-3 ISO 15765-4 ISO 14229 ISO 14230 SAE J1979 |
NMEA 2000 | ssNMEA2000 è uno stack di protocollo NMEA 2000 dalle elevate prestazioni che supporta un flusso di dati di 20 Mbps. Il prodotto è ottimizzato specificatamente per C2000. | NMEA 2000 NMEA 2000-A NMEA 2000-B NMEA 2000-E IEC 61162-3 |
Dagli MCU MSP430™ a consumo ultraridotto fino ai controller in real-time ad alte prestazioni TMS320C2000™, e dagli MCU per la sicurezza Hercules™ con tecnologia ARM® a 32 bit fino agli MCU TM4C12x ARM® Cortex™-M4, TI offre la più ampia gamma di prodotti per il controllo integrato.